Conference Hotel
The Westin Lima Hotel & Convention Center
An iconic hotel in Lima, conveniently located in the exclusive San Isidro district, in the financial center of the city and 15 minutes from the Miraflores district and the Historic Center of Lima. Since 2011, with modern facilities and the most welcoming staff, it is ready to welcome you and ensure your well-being if you travel to Peru for business or vacation.

About Lima
In Lima everything is in endless movement, and even the past is constantly being rediscovered. Lima offers an extraordinary range of emotions, sensations, colors and flavors: travelers can visit the city’s impressive cathedral, fly over the ocean, enjoy a photogenic sunset, or savor unmatched cuisine.
Lima is a place of converging trends, created by its people and their living culture, where you will find every corner of Peru represented. One visit to Lima can never be enough. Lima, filled with colonial-era riches, is the only capital in South America that faces the sea, and it is hailed as the gastronomic capital of Latin America.
